DePuy Synthes is recruiting for an EMEA Education Lead, located in Leeds, West Yorkshire, United Kingdom OR Zuchwil, Switzerland. The EMEA Education Lead is responsible for defining and executing the Professional and Commercial Education strategy across EMEA in support of DePuy Synthes’ Commercial priorities. This role pulls through the Global Business Unit Education strategies and partners closely with Sales, Marketing, Medical Affairs, and regional leadership to design and deliver high‑impact educational programs that build clinical capability, accelerate adoption of solutions, and support sustainable business growth. This is a highly visible regional role with the opportunity to shape how surgeons and healthcare professionals engage with DePuy Synthes technologies across diverse EMEA markets.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ead the EMEA Professional and Commercial Education strategies aligned with regional Commercial objectives and global education frameworks.
  • Design, deploy, and continuously improve surgeon and healthcare professional education programs, including courses, workshops, labs, and digital learning experiences.
  • Partner with Commercial, Marketing, and Medical Affairs teams to ensure education initiatives support product launches, portfolio priorities, and capability building.
  • Oversee planning, execution, and governance of regional and local education events, ensuring compliance with internal policies and external regulations.
  • Manage relationships with key faculty, societies, training centers, and external partners across EMEA.
  • Analyze education effectiveness using defined metrics and insights to optimize program impact and return on investment.
  • Provide guidance and support to country education teams to ensure consistency, quality, and scalability of education delivery.
  • Manage education budgets, forecasting, and resource allocation across the region.
  • Ensure all Professional Education activities adhere to Johnson & Johnson Credo values, compliance, and quality standards.

Qualifications

Education Required: Bachelor’s degree in Life Sciences, Healthcare, Business, Education, or a related field. Preferred: Advanced degree (MBA, Master’s in Education, Healthcare, or related discipline).

Experience and Skills Required: Progressive experience (typically 10-12 years) in professional education, medical education, commercial enablement, or related roles within medical devices, healthcare, or life sciences. Proven experience leading regional or multi‑country education initiatives in EMEA. Strong understanding of Commercial strategy, customer education, and capability building. Demonstrated ability to work cross‑functionally with Sales, Marketing, and Medical Affairs teams. Experience managing budgets, vendors, and external faculty or partners. Strong communication, presentation, and stakeholder‑management skills.

Preferred: Experience within Orthopedics or Medical Devices. Background in surgeon or HCP training program design and delivery. Experience supporting new product introductions through education. Familiarity with adult learning principles and blended learning models (in‑person and digital). Prior people leadership or matrix leadership experience.

Other: Languages: Fluent in English and other European languages are a plus. Travel: Up to 40–50%, primarily within EMEA, with occasional global travel. Certifications: Professional education, instructional design, or project management certifications are a plus.
